Mallrat dissects human connection on ‘Hocus Pocus’ (new single + video out now)
Mallrat today shares her second release of the year, the animated ‘Hocus Pocus’, charged with a misty electronic soundscape. LISTEN HERE + WATCH HERE.
Embracing her experimental roots, ‘Hocus Pocus’ juxtaposes a Memphis rap sample of DJ Zirk’s ‘Born2 Lose’ with spacey broken beat and bass, painting a dream of human interaction. Produced by Styalz Fuego (Troye Sivan, Tate McRae) and Kito (Skrillex, FLETCHER), the club-led release maintains a sleek intimacy in sound, continuing on Mallrat’s inquisitive exploration of light amongst human relationships from the solace first found in ‘Ray Of Light’.

Speaking to its making, of ‘Hocus Pocus’ Mallrat shares, “I fell over and fractured my arm dancing to this demo on a walk home. I couldn’t help but be excited! I had to wear a cast and sling. When I was writing the pre-chorus section of this song I was thinking of the sharp inhale breaths as lyrics that needed their own moment, kind of like a punchline. A lot of the time in pop music, breaths are edited out and turned down, but they felt important here to me.”
With the release comes a cosmic music video directed by Tom Carroll, illustrating an interplay of divergent forces, further cementing the praise for Mallrat’s astute balance of the picturesque with the acerbic in her latest release ‘Ray Of Light’. Mallrat has been breaking barriers since her influential debut in 2016 – accumulating over half a billion career streams in her discography and ARIA Platinum status. The project of Grace Shaw has shared stages with Maggie Rogers, Post Malone, King Princess, Conan Gray; collaborated with Azealia Banks, The Chainsmokers, BENEE, Blu DeTiger, Cub Sport; a late night TV debut on The Late Late Show with James Corden; headline world tours amongst globally recognised festivals Reading and Leeds, Austin City Limits, Laneway, Splendour In The Grass, Listen Out and boasts multiple triple j Hottest 100 entries from 2017 – 2020.
